Output dce59a7e760a6174bc376b61a243bb935b1196c68472091fec552b923107a36f:25

value
2262038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e95c0bc65ee92e4111dda0147bc350007794e56d OP_EQUAL
address
3Nxudi2S83tL6DavGdW7u6JtisRuhmf9vm
transaction
dce59a7e760a6174bc376b61a243bb935b1196c68472091fec552b923107a36f